GUIDE FOR JOOMLA DEVELOPERS FUNDAMENTALS EXPLAINED

guide for Joomla developers Fundamentals Explained

guide for Joomla developers Fundamentals Explained

Blog Article

Definitely! Below's the thorough material for SEO posts 7 and 8 based on your key phrases related to Joomla.

Just how to Develop Your Initial Joomla Site: A Total Guide
Creating a web site can feel like an overwhelming job, specifically if you are unfamiliar with web advancement. Nonetheless, with Joomla, an open-source web content management system (CMS), building an internet site becomes much simpler and more available. Whether you're building a personal blog, a small business site, or a big corporate site, Joomla provides the tools and versatility to fulfill your requirements. In this detailed guide, we'll walk you with the steps to construct your initial Joomla website, covering everything from installment to modification.

Why Joomla?
Joomla is among the most popular CMS systems offered today. It powers millions of internet sites globally and is understood for its flexibility, scalability, and straightforward interface. What makes Joomla stand apart from various other CMS choices is its flexibility-- it can be made use of to develop a large range of websites, from basic individual blog sites to complex, data-driven web sites for large business.

Among the major advantages of using Joomla is its built-in capacities for content administration. The system enables you to conveniently add, edit, and arrange your content with a basic, instinctive interface. Additionally, Joomla offers a durable collection of features, including:

Comprehensive modification alternatives with plugins, components, and expansions.
Assistance for multi-language websites, making it a fantastic choice for global companies.
SEO-friendly tools to assist your site rank better in online search engine.
Safety and security functions to safeguard your website from prospective risks.
Step-by-Step Overview to Building a Joomla Site
Step 1: Install Joomla on Your Server
The initial step to creating your Joomla website is to mount the system on your server. Many organizing companies offer one-click installments for Joomla, making the process straightforward. If you like to mount Joomla manually, follow these actions:

Download Joomla from the main site at https://www.joomla.org/download.html.
Post Joomla to your server making use of an FTP customer (such as FileZilla) or via the hosting control panel.
Create a MySQL data source for Joomla with your organizing supplier's control board (e.g., cPanel).
Run the Joomla setup manuscript by navigating to your web site's domain and following the on-screen guidelines.
Step 2: Set Up Joomla's Basic Configuration
After installation, you'll be guided to the Joomla control board where you can start configuring your website. The initial point you'll require to do is set up the standard settings:

Site Name: This is the name that will appear in your web site's title tag and in the internet browser's tab.
Website Summary: Include a quick description of your website to help visitors understand its objective.
Timezone and Language: Select the right timezone and recommended language for your web site.
User Enrollment: Decide if you want to permit customers to sign up accounts on your website.
Step 3: Choose a Template for Your Website
Joomla provides a selection of layouts to personalize your site's look. Layouts establish the format, style, and color design of your site. You can either use a cost-free theme available via Joomla or buy a premium theme from third-party service providers.

To mount a theme:

Go to Expansions > Manage > Install in the Joomla control board.
Submit your template data (normally in a.zip format).
Trigger the design template by mosting likely to Expansions > Layouts > Designs and picking your wanted template.
Tip 4: Develop Web content
With your website up and running, it's time to develop web content. Joomla makes use of a framework of articles and classifications to organize content. Below's how to get going:

Produce Classifications: Go to Web Content > Categories > Add New Category. Groups assist arrange your short articles into sensible groups (e.g., blog posts, news, or solutions).
Produce Articles: Go to Web Content > Articles > Include New Short Article. Create your material, include media, and assign your post to the appropriate group.
Step 5: Develop Menus for Navigation
Food selections are necessary for helping site visitors browse your website. In Joomla, you can produce food selections to organize your web content and produce a smooth customer experience.

To create a brand-new menu:

Go to Menus > Key Food Selection > Include New Menu Item.
Select the sort of food selection item (such as a short article, classification blog site, or exterior URL).
Assign the appropriate article or group to the food selection item and offer it a name.
Step 6: Mount Extensions for Extra Characteristics
Joomla allows you to set up expansions to add additional functions and functionality to your site. These can vary from SEO devices to ecommerce remedies. Some popular Joomla extensions consist of:

SEO Extensions: Extensions like sh404SEF or Joomla search engine optimization can aid enhance your internet site for search engines.
Ecommerce: If you're developing an on-line store, install an extension like VirtueMart or HikaShop to handle products, repayments, and orders.
Social Media Combination: Add social sharing buttons and feeds to your site with expansions like JFBConnect or Easy Social.
Action 7: Test and Introduce Your Site
As soon as you have actually produced material, personalized your site, and set up any type of required extensions, it's time to test your website. Check for broken links, make certain the website is mobile-friendly, and check the customer experience. After making any type of final changes, publish your website and make it live for the world to see.

Conclusion
Structure your very first Joomla website is an amazing and satisfying process. By adhering to these actions, you can develop a completely useful web site that meets your demands. With Joomla's considerable personalization alternatives, the possibilities for your web site are endless. Whether you're producing an individual blog or a shopping site, Joomla supplies the devices and versatility to make it occur.

Exactly How to Include Advanced Features to Your Joomla Site
As soon as you have actually produced the standard framework of your Joomla site, you might want to broaden its performance with innovative features. Joomla is an incredibly versatile CMS, and it supplies a wide variety of extensions, components, and devices to enhance your website. In this article, we'll dive into how to add some sophisticated functions to your Joomla site to take it to the next level.

1. Install Advanced Search Engine Optimization Tools
Search engine optimization (SEARCH ENGINE OPTIMIZATION) is essential for driving traffic to your Joomla website. By maximizing your website for internet search engine, you increase its visibility and improve your rankings. Joomla has a variety of integrated search engine optimization features, but you can boost these functions with powerful SEO devices.

SEO Extensions to Take Into Consideration:

sh404SEF: This expansion assists with generating search engine-friendly Links and metadata. It also provides analytics to assist you track your website's SEO efficiency.
Joomla search engine optimization: A thorough tool that permits you to maximize metadata, manage redirects, and monitor internet search engine rankings.
Yoast search engine optimization: While Yoast is largely understood for WordPress, there is a Joomla variation available to supply guidance on SEO finest methods straight within the Joomla user interface.
With the best SEO devices in position, you can optimize each post and web page for the keyword phrases you intend to rate for. Make sure to include appropriate titles, meta summaries, and key phrases throughout your website's web content.

2. Develop an E-commerce Store
If you want to sell products on your Joomla website, you can change it right into a full-fledged shopping shop. Joomla supports a number of powerful ecommerce extensions that enable you to set up a shopping click here cart, take care of supply, and procedure settlements.

Shopping Expansions to Consider:

VirtueMart: One of one of the most preferred Joomla ecommerce services. VirtueMart integrates perfectly with Joomla and uses functions such as product directory administration, customer accounts, and an integrated payment entrance.
HikaShop: An user-friendly expansion that allows you to develop an on the internet store easily. HikaShop gives a range of repayment and shipping choices, as well as tools for item management.
J2Store: An easy yet effective e-commerce expansion for Joomla. It allows you to offer both physical and digital items and incorporates with various repayment portals.
By installing one of these shopping extensions, you can start selling items, manage orders, and also incorporate features like coupons and discount rates.

3. Include Social Media Combination
Social media site is an effective device for driving traffic and engaging with your audience. Adding social media integration to your Joomla site enables visitors to share your material quickly and follow your social media sites accounts.

Social Media Site Expansions to Think About:

JFBConnect: This extension allows you to integrate Facebook login, sharing switches, and social feeds right into your Joomla site.
EasySocial: A social networking extension for Joomla that aids you construct an area on your web site. It integrates with major social media systems like Facebook, Twitter, and Instagram.
Social Hyperlinks: A lightweight expansion that includes social networks buttons to your Joomla write-ups, making it easy for users to share your web content on their chosen social systems.
4. Include a Blog Section
Several Joomla individuals pick to include a blog as component of their site. A blog site is a terrific method to share updates, write-ups, and other web content with your audience. Luckily, Joomla makes it easy to add a blog site section to your site.

Just how to Add a Blog to Joomla:

Develop a new Group for your blog posts.
Produce Articles within this group.
Set up a Food selection thing that connects to your blog site category, so visitors can quickly browse to it.
Additionally, you can install blog-specific extensions to improve the performance of your blog site, such as EasyBlog or JoomlaBlog.

5. Boost Website Performance with Caching and Compression
To guarantee that your Joomla site tons promptly, it's necessary to enhance its performance. Slow-loading internet sites can adversely influence customer experience and search engine optimization positions. Joomla supplies a variety of devices and expansions to enhance web site speed.

Performance Optimization Extensions:

JotCache: A caching extension that aids improve website efficiency by caching static pages, lowering the lots on your web server.
Joomla PageSpeed: This expansion compresses and optimizes images, CSS, and JavaScript submits to accelerate page lots times.
Akeeba Backup: In addition to efficiency enhancements, Akeeba Backup gives back-up and recover attributes for your Joomla website, making sure that your web content is risk-free.
Conclusion
Adding innovative functions to your Joomla website permits you to personalize it further and add capability to satisfy your details needs. Whether you're aiming to maximize for SEO, include ecommerce capability, or improve efficiency, Joomla has the devices and extensions essential to improve your website. By executing these sophisticated attributes, you can create a site that is not just aesthetically enticing but also practical, straightforward, and maximized for search engines.

Report this page